التعريف
To repeatedly tell or remind someone to do something, often in a way that feels annoying or persistent.

استمع في السياق
My mom is always on at me to clean my room.
The teacher was on at the students about their homework.
Stop being on at your brother—he's doing his best.
I wish my boss would stop being on at me about deadlines.
